CASPER, Wyo. — After much anticipation, Evansville’s Chili’s restaurant held its grand opening at 10 a.m. on Monday, Aug. 8.
The ribbon-cutting ceremony was held “with welcome comments from Bruce Shively, owner, Casper Area Chamber of Commerce, Town of Evansville, Paul Bertoglio, Representative Pat Sweeney & other dignitaries,” Jereca Lutz told Oil City News. “They are excited to officially be open for business and cannot wait to serve everyone!”
Chili’s has been in the works for several months, obtaining its liquor license on July 25 from Evansville Town Council. The fast-casual dining chain now has three locations in Wyoming, offering a diverse menu and full bar.
The restaurant is located at 510 E. Lathrop Road in Evansville.
